Audio Menu Functions

The Audio Menu features the following functions.

Balance Adjustment (FADER)

This function allows you to select a Fader/Balance setting that provides ideal listening con-
ditions in all occupied seats.
1. Press the AUDIO button and select the Fader/Balance mode (FADER) in the
Audio Menu.
2. Adjust front/rear speaker bal-
ance with the 5/∞ buttons.
"FADER :F15" – "FADER :R15" is
displayed as it moves from front to
rear.
3. Adjust left/right speaker bal-
ance with the 2/3 buttons.
"BAL :L 9" – "BAL :R 9" is dis-
played as it moves from left to right.
Note:
• "FADER : 0" is the proper setting when 2 speakers are in use.
Equalizer Curve Adjustment (EQ-LOW/MID/HIGH)
You can adjust the currently selected equalizer curve settings as desired. Adjusted equaliz-
er curve settings are memorized in "CUSTOM".
1. Press the AUDIO button and select the Equalizer mode
(EQ-LOW/MID/HIGH) in the Audio Menu.
2. Select the band you want to
adjust with the 2/3 buttons.
EQ-LOW + = EQ-MID + = EQ-HIGH
